The line "Citizenship and values" refers to research on the civic and axiological dimension of education. It is based on the assumption that pedagogical research must necessarily include reflection and study of the world of values, attitudes and ethical thinking.
It approaches the learning of a model of coexistence, both at school and social level. It focuses on the development of people's autonomy and responsibility, employing as the basic technique the learning of social norms through democratic procedures.

The research in this line aims to analyse the educational use of ICTs and to analyse the keys to the construction of media citizenship. It also aims to study the use of video games in education and the use of serious games in complex environments.

This line deals with the analysis of teaching-learning processes at the university in order to make proposals for improvement and to implement and evaluate them, as far as possible. Likewise, good practices, the use of ICTs, transition processes, dropout and failure, etc.
